Mprizoliera Large 2015
Mprizoliera Large 2015 was recalled on 4 December 2015 under EU Safety Gate alert A11/0106/15. Burns risk reported by Cyprus. When the product is operated for a period of more than 30 minutes, the metal pan handle gets too hot and could burn the user.
| Alert Number | A11/0106/15 |
| Brand | Unknown |
| Category | Electrical appliances and equipment |
| Risk Type | Burns |
| Notifying Country | Cyprus |
| Country of Origin | Cyprus |
| Model Number | A32BL |
| Published | 4 December 2015 |
Risk Description
When the product is operated for a period of more than 30 minutes, the metal pan handle gets too hot and could burn the user.The product does not comply with the requirements of the Low Voltage Directive and the relevant European standard EN 60335.
Measures Taken
Type of economic operator to whom the measure(s) were ordered: OtherCategory of measure(s): Withdrawal of the product from the marketDate of entry into force: 27/10/2015
Product Description
Electric grill, 230V, 50Hz, 800W, packed in a plain cardboard box.
